인프런 커뮤니티 질문&답변

이재일님의 프로필 이미지
이재일

작성한 질문수

인스타그램 클론 - full stack 웹 개발

댓글 :: model, admin

comment, class에서 status 는 정의를 안했는데 사용할 수 있나요???

작성

·

170

1

@login_required
def comment_delete(request):
    pk = request.POST.get('pk')
    comment = get_object_or_404(Comment, pk=pk)
    if request.method == 'POST' and request.user == comment.author:
        comment.delete()
        message = '삭제완료'
        status = 1
    
    else:
        message = '잘못된 접근입니다'
        status = 0
        
    return HttpResponse(json.dumps({'message': message, 'status': status, }), content_type="application/json")


여기서 질문드러요!!

답변 2

0

이재일님의 프로필 이미지
이재일
질문자

아하 넵!

0

카인드패밀리님의 프로필 이미지
카인드패밀리
지식공유자

이재일님 안녕하세요 ~ ^ ^ 
status 값은 ajax로 요청을 보냈을때 반환값으로 데이터베이스에 저장되는 내용은 아니에요 그래서 class에서 별도로 지정해 주지 않아도 사용이 가능하세요 ㅎ

이재일님의 프로필 이미지
이재일

작성한 질문수

질문하기